Two Odisha police personnel awarded Shaurya Chakra

| @indiablooms | Aug 15, 2021, at 04:53 am

Bhubaneswar/UNI: Ministry of Defence has announced Shaurya Chakra for two Odisha Police personnel Martyr Commando Debasis Sethy and Martyr Commando Sudhir Kumar Tudu of SOG.

Shaurya Chakra is awarded for exemplary bravery, valour and courageous action.

In a release, Odisha police thanked the Union Government for conferring this prestigious honour on two sons of Odisha Police.

Both the Police personnel were engaged in an operation against LW Extremists on September 9, 2020, in dense forest near village Sikri in Kalahandi district.

Both put their own lives in danger and showed exemplary bravery.

"On this occasion we express our gratitude and pride for their valiant action. Both Commando Debasis Sethy and Commando Sudhir Kumar Tudu remain in the hearts of Odisha Police personnel,’’ the release said.
